区块链技术,作为数字货币的基石,近年来引起了广泛关注。它不仅改变了人们对货币的认知,还在金融、供应链管理等多个领域展现出巨大潜力。今天,我们就来揭秘区块链记账原理,带您深入了解数字货币背后的秘密。
区块链记账的基本概念
区块链是一种去中心化的分布式账本技术,它通过将数据分块,并以链式结构存储,实现了数据的安全、透明和不可篡改。在区块链中,记账是整个系统运作的核心环节。
区块
区块链中的数据以区块的形式存储。每个区块包含以下信息:
- 区块头:包括区块版本、前一个区块的哈希值、默克尔根、时间戳、难度目标、随机数等。
- 交易列表:记录在该区块内发生的所有交易。
- 区块体:对交易列表进行加密后的数据。
链式结构
区块链采用链式结构,每个区块都包含前一个区块的哈希值,形成一条不断延伸的链。这种结构保证了区块链的不可篡改性。
区块链记账原理
区块链记账原理主要基于以下步骤:
交易生成:用户发起交易,交易包含发送方、接收方、金额等信息。
交易验证:网络中的节点对交易进行验证,确保交易合法、有效。
区块创建:验证通过的交易被收集到新区块中,新区块包含一定数量的交易。
区块加密:新区块通过加密算法进行加密,形成区块头。
区块广播:新区块被广播到整个网络,所有节点接收到新区块后,将其添加到自己的区块链中。
共识机制:网络中的节点通过共识机制确认新区块的合法性,并更新自己的区块链。
区块链记账的优势
安全性:区块链采用加密算法,确保数据安全,防止篡改。
透明性:区块链上的数据对所有节点公开,用户可以随时查看交易记录。
高效性:区块链采用分布式架构,数据处理速度快,降低了交易成本。
去中心化:区块链不依赖于中心化机构,降低了系统风险。
数字货币与区块链的关系
数字货币是区块链技术的一个应用场景。在区块链上,数字货币的交易记录被永久保存,保证了货币的安全和透明。
总结
区块链记账原理为我们揭示了数字货币背后的秘密。它不仅是一种创新的技术,更是一种颠覆性的变革。随着区块链技术的不断发展,我们有理由相信,它在未来将发挥更大的作用。
